[pyar] Herencia y métodos __ (double underscore)

Roberto Alsina ralsina en netmanagers.com.ar
Mar Mar 20 13:17:09 ART 2012


On 3/20/2012 1:10 PM, Manuel Kaufmann wrote:
> Hola lista,
>
> Estoy tratando de resolver un bug de OLPC[1] y me encontré con un
> problema de herencia. No estoy seguro si es así como debería funcionar
> o estoy meando afuera del tarro o encontré un bug de Python o he
> quemado demasiadas neuronas ya.
>
> La cosa es así: tengo una clase Hola que tiene un método "__me_voy" y
> una clase Chau que también tiene un método "__me_voy". Chau hereda de
> Hola y en el __init__ de Hola se llama a self.__me_voy. ¿Cuál se
> debería llamar ahí el de Chau o el de Hola? Para mí el de Chau, pero
> para Python (que siempre sabe más que yo) dice que se debe llamar el
> de Hola.
<http://docs.python.org/release/1.5/tut/node67.html>
http://www.python.org/dev/peps/pep-0008/

Busca la parte de "double underscore"  :-)
------------ próxima parte ------------
Se ha borrado un adjunto en formato HTML...
URL: <http://listas.python.org.ar/pipermail/pyar/attachments/20120320/1c634fb7/attachment.html>


More information about the pyar mailing list